I'm sure people heard this Arn Anderson story as people like Prichard told it and podcast wrestlers talked about it (not smarks).
Basically Arn with a group of wrestlers saying 'you all think I'm somebody, right' and they all angry, he's Arn, legend etc
Points to himself ... "midcarder"
Only worked at the top if I'm with Flair otherwise midcard and used to make people look good
To a lot of you guys here, that's nothing. You're already in spots higher than me etc
Dropping some truth on people
That some wrestlers make themselves miserable about what they haven't got or done but don't realise what they have done and how they're admired by fans etc

Giulia isn't made for American audiences. She's not flashy. She can't do promos, and really had to work for a while to get them to work in Japan. Heck, people doubted her wrestling skills in Stardom for a long time.
She was a terrible rookie, without natural talent, and really had to outwork the competition. Her projected arrogance and bullying got her over. Being small and mute in WWE is going to be a very tough road.
